1. Cosmetology or beauty schools

Local cosmetology and beauty schools can be an excellent option to avoid expensive haircuts. Beauty students take the opportunity to practice their skills and gain experience.

Students work under the supervision of highly experienced instructors to ensure everything runs smoothly. Depending on what you need, you can come by or call ahead to make an appointment and find out prices.

Prices at local cosmetology schools are often significantly cheaper than at a salon or barber shop. Make sure you tell the student clearly what you want to do, or bring a photo.

Keep in mind that they wouldn't get their hair done if they didn't have the requisite hours and basic training under their belts, so you'll probably be pleasantly surprised with the end result.

3. Stylist working from home

A work-from-home stylist is a fantastic choice for saving money on your hair care routine. I go to one for my hair and I love it.

Some might say that home stylists aren't professionals, but that's usually not true.

Some stylists prefer to work from home because it's more flexible. Or they may prefer not to pay a fee to rent a chair if they have a large clientele of their own.

Finding a barber to cut your hair from home can save you a lot of money. Ask friends and family for recommendations, or look for recommendations in local Facebook groups.

You can also ask for photos of their work or references. If you don't mind skipping the salon/barbershop experience, this could be a great alternative.

5. Charity Events

Throughout the year, some organizations offer discounts on haircuts. Some events focus on people with financial difficulties, while others are open to the public.

For example, you typically see free or discounted haircuts at local back-to-school events.

My family and I attended some of these events and there were plenty of giveaways, including back to school hairstyles for kids.

Hair Cuttery has been offering free haircuts as part of a charity event since 1999. Most of the 900+ salons across the country participate in the Share-A-Haircut event.

Hair Cuttery typically selects a few days a year to offer free haircut certificates per haircut purchased, according to the website.

They have run various campaigns over the years. In 2018, Hair Cuttery joined the National Network to End Domestic Violence, whose goal was to raise awareness of domestic violence.

They offered haircuts to victims of domestic violence through a network of local programs and nationwide coalitions. Between 2014 and 2018, the two teamed up to donate nearly 250,000 haircuts worth around $5.27 million.

Sometimes Hair Cuttery focuses on the homeless and gives out thousands of free haircut certificates to those in need.

7. Cut your own hair

A great way to save money is to cut your own hair. I have a neighbor who cuts the hair of the whole family, including her four children and her husband.

She's a stay-at-home mom, but she has a part-time job cutting her hair at a local hair salon, so she makes extra money with that skill as well.
